The Case Manager will report to the Clinical Supervisor. In collaboration with other members of the clinical team, the case manager is responsible for serving as a liaison for the treatment team, client, families and collateral service providers.
Positions are available NOW throughout New Hampshire! Responsibilities:
• Maintains assigned caseload and ensures the proper implementation of in-home services in accordance with referrals made by DCYF.
• Works collaboratively with DCYF to respond to referral requests, create treatment plans, participate in treatment meetings, and provide regular service specific documentation.
• Develops and collaborates on treatment plan formation with measurable and attainable goals in partnership with families and DCYF.
• Adheres to all documentation requirements of service delivery including assessment writing and report writing.
• Participates in reporting progress to the court system through in person appearances and written reporting as requested.
• Provides parent education and supervised visitation to children, adults, and families in home and community-based settings.
• Offers parent coaching and support including provision of effective parenting strategies, meeting healthcare and educational needs of children, understanding developmental milestones, meal preparation and budgeting.
• Enforces supervised visitation expectations as identified by DCYF to ensure child safety.
• Interfaces with DCYF, the NH court system, schools, behavioral health providers, and any other involved members of the treatment team as necessary to provide quality service delivery.
• Successfully assesses client risk on an ongoing basis and consult with clinical supervisor regarding any safety concerns.
• Transportation of clients, including children and adults, requiring car seat and booster seat installation.
• On-call rotation : responsible for responding to phone to provide support to families as utilized.
• Early evening availability required for working hours. Most visits to clients are in the afternoon or early evenings. Must have flexible availability to work due to this. Schedule/hours are subject to our clients needs.
• Ability to successfully document all clinical contacts and documentation through Electronic Health System.
• Other duties as assigned. Required Experience:
- Bachelor's Degree with a major in social work, counseling, psychology or related human services field
- Two years minimum experience working with children, youth and families in a home or community setting preferred
- Valid driver's license with reliable and consistent access to a vehicle
